President Jair Bolsonaro said this Monday (22) that the government has been working for the privatization of companies like Correios and Eletrobras and, remembering that a good part of them depends on the approval of the National Congress, he complained that the processes are not moving forward.

Questioned by a supporter upon returning to Palácio da Alvorada, the president said that the privatization process does not consist of “putting it on the shelf” and advertising to buyers.

“Most of them pass through the Parliament. We are fighting for the Post Office, for Eletrobras… It’s not going,” he said.

Eletrobras last week updated the schedule for its privatization, now forecasting that the “follow-on” operation will take place until May of next year.

The bill that deals with the privatization of Correios is pending a vote in the Senate’s CAE (Economic Affairs Commission).
